In Support of Free Mom Hugs
Free Mom Hugs is a 501(c)3 nonprofit organization that works to empower the world to celebrate the LGBTQIA+ community through visibility, education and conversation. Born of one Oklahoma mom’s simple act of wearing a homemade Free Mom Hugs button to a Pride festival, today Free Mom Hugs has more than 50,000 volunteers, chapters in all 50 states, and affiliate chapters around the world.
Free Mom Hugs volunteers give hugs and go beyond the hug, too. Our volunteers give hugs at events and other gatherings and further support and affirm LGBTQIA+ individuals through public education and outreach.
